The Credit Mobilier scandal tarnished the Grant administration by exposing widespread corruption involving high-ranking officials and members of Congress. The scandal revolved around the fraudulent construction contracts for the Union Pacific Railroad, where politicians were found to have accepted bribes in the form of discounted stock. This revelation damaged public trust in the government and highlighted the pervasive influence of corporate interests in politics during Grant's presidency, contributing to a perception of ineptitude and corruption in his administration. Ultimately, it marked a significant blemish on Grant's legacy, overshadowing some of his achievements.

Who was implicated in the Credit Mobilier scandal?

Congressman Oakes Ames was the core player in the Credit Mobilier scandal, however, over 30 other individuals participated in the scandal. Oakes Ames and James Brooks were censured by a congressional investigation.

What was the credit mobile scandal?

The Credit Mobilier scandal involved the Credit Mobilier Company and the Union Pacific Railroad. Both were chartered in 1864. In 1868, Congressman Oakes Ames distributed shares of Credit Mobilier stock, as well as made cash bribes to other congressmen. The Sun, a New York newspaper, broke the story of the scandal during the 1872 presidential campaign of Ulysses Grant.
